I have 2 CCX clusters (both 8.0.2, soon to be 8.5.1) integrated with a single UCM 8.5.1 cluster. Is there a way to "hide" agents in one cluster from reporting in the other cluster? The issue I have is that admins from CCX cluster 2 have to sort through the dozens of agents from CCX cluster 1 in some of the reports just to pick out the few agents that belong to them. They don't actually see call stats from CCX1, but all of the agents from CCX1 show up in the filter list for CCX2. Removing the IPCC extension in UCM will drop the agent from both customers. Is there any way to drop an agent from just one cluster and not the other?

No - this is one of the drawbacks of the design. There's only one 'ipcc extension' property and no way to partition the users off...

Most agent reports can be run based on Resource Group. Just assign your agents in different clusters to 2 different resource groups and use the detailed tab of the agent report to select the resource group.

Unfortunately, some of the common reports don't filter on resource groups, such as the Abandoned Call Report.

You could edit the report template's xml file (on the supervisors pc) to display only the agents you want. See the thread below for an example on how to do this with CSQs.
